B2B, or business-to-business, wholesale is a model where businesses sell products directly to other businesses. This sector has seen significant growth with the increasing demand for daily goods on a global scale. Manufacturers and suppliers are leveraging online platforms to reach a wider audience, which has streamlined the purchasing process.
With the rise of e-commerce, businesses are now able to source daily goods from suppliers across the globe without the traditional barriers of location. This trend has made it easier for retailers to stock their shelves with high-demand products at competitive prices.
B2B wholesale offers several advantages, including bulk purchasing, reduced costs, and a direct line of communication with manufacturers. Businesses can negotiate deals that benefit both parties, ensuring a steady supply of goods.
For manufacturers, expanding into the B2B wholesale market opens new avenues for exports. Suppliers can tap into international markets, broadening their reach and increasing their sales potential. Staying compliant with export regulations and understanding market demands are crucial for success.
